Online reviews are central to how travelers choose vacation rentals. Positive ratings attract guests, improve search rankings, instill confidence, and drive bookings and revenue. Ten tips to maximize reviews on a new listing:
- Focus on impeccable quality — clean, well-maintained properties with comfortable bedding, reliable Wi-Fi, and clear instructions earn rave reviews.
- Encourage feedback — politely request a review after the stay with a personalized follow-up, and weave the ask into check-out.
- Optimize your listing — compelling descriptions and high-quality photos that showcase unique features and nearby attractions.
- Prioritize communication — respond promptly and courteously to every review, thanking positives and constructively addressing negatives.
- Leverage social media — share guest testimonials, photos, and stories to amplify positive experiences and reach.
- Incentivize reviews — offer discounts on future stays, perks, or a prize draw for leaving feedback.
- Collaborate with influential voices — invite travel influencers or local experts to experience the property and share honest reviews.
- Monitor your online reputation — track review platforms and social channels, and resolve negative feedback with empathy.
- Use review platforms and directories — claim your listings, keep info and photos current, and engage with reviewers.
- Continuously refine — read recurring feedback patterns and adjust your property and service over time.
